Looks like the Feds have approved the "jug handle" bridge proposal for NC12. In a nutshell, they are spending almost 2 hundred million on a (very small) bridge/causeway that goes out into the sound and bypasses a difficult section of highway that gets damaged or flooded with every hurricane that hits the OBX.
